要使用ThinkPHP进行数据分页操作,可以按照以下步骤:
count()
函数获取数据总数。$data = Db::table('table_name')->where($condition)->select();
$count = Db::table('table_name')->where($condition)->count();
$page = new \think\paginator\driver\Bootstrap($data, $page_size, $count);
render()
方法生成分页链接。<div class="pagination">
<?php echo $page->render(); ?>
</div>
关键词说明:
ThinkPHP
:一个基于MVC模式的PHP开发框架。数据分页
:将大量数据分为多页进行显示,以提高用户体验。count()
:ThinkPHP中的查询构造器函数,用于获取数据总数。分页器
:ThinkPHP中的分页类,用于处理分页逻辑。render()
:分页器的方法,用于生成分页链接。模板
:ThinkPHP中的视图层,用于显示数据。